It’s basically a question of what kind of holiday you’re looking for. If it’s a family holiday with lots of new experiences, I’d opt for France. Only problem might be that France, like most of Europe, is not necessarily very warm at this time of the year.

But no matter what the weather, France has so much to offer: great food and drink everywhere, also in small cafes and local countryside restaurants. Wonderful museums. Skiing in the Alps…

so, make a list of what sort of things you want to do, compare the two alternatives, and then make your decision.
